Please ensure the connection was made after you've installed the latest nightly. It will not fix existing connections as noted in my reply below.

www.joomlapolis.com/forum/153-professional-member-support/231370-5538-time-display-error-in-connection-path?limitstart=0#271411

It will store the UTC datetime the connection was established then display it local based off the users timezone or the servers timezone if the user does not have one set.
